2. Calendar
The Gregorian calendar is the most widely used calendar system today. It was introduced in 1582 by Pope Gregory XIII and is a modification of the Julian calendar, which was introduced by Julius Caesar in 46 BC. The Gregorian calendar is a solar calendar, meaning that it is based on the Earth’s orbit around the Sun. It has 365 days in a year, with an extra day added in leap years to account for the fact that the Earth’s orbit is not exactly 365 days long.

Facet 1: Accuracy
The Gregorian calendar is more accurate than the Julian calendar, which it replaced. The Julian calendar had a leap year every four years, which resulted in an average year length of 365.25 days. This was slightly longer than the Earth’s actual orbit around the Sun, which is 365.242 days. Over time, this difference caused the calendar to drift out of sync with the seasons.
